decl.c (finish_case_label): Do not check that we are within a switch statement here.
* decl.c (finish_case_label): Do not check that we are within a switch statement here. * parser.c (struct cp_parser): Add in_iteration_statement_p and in_switch_statement_p. (cp_parser_new): Initialize them. (cp_parser_labeled_statement): Check validity of case labels here. (cp_parser_selection_statement): Set in_switch_statement_p. (cp_parser_iteration_statement): Set in_iteration_statement_p. (cp_parser_jump_statement): Check validity of break/continue statements here. From-SVN: r73508
